Add 70/56 and 6/72
1st number: 1 14/56, 2nd number: 6/72
70/56 + 6/72 is 4/3.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 56 and 72 is 504
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 504 - For the 1st fraction, since 56 × 9 = 504,
70/56 = 70 × 9/56 × 9 = 630/504 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 72 × 7 = 504,
6/72 = 6 × 7/72 × 7 = 42/504 - Add the two like fractions:
630/504 + 42/504 = 630 + 42/504 = 672/504 - 672/504 simplified gives 4/3
- So, 70/56 + 6/72 = 4/3
